While you are in Frayssinet, ensure you allow time to visit more of Midi-Pyrenees. Take a gander at the ruins and castles in Midi-Pyrenees. Visitors can also take the time to enjoy its rural landscapes, rivers and canals. In this region of France, visitors may also try their hand at snowboarding.

Cahors is 20 kilometres to the south of Frayssinet and is home to the Pont Valentre, Cahors Cathedral and Place Jean-Jacques Chapou. Alternatively, you could stay in Souillac, 30 kilometres to the north of Frayssinet, where you'll find the Hôtel Belle Vue and Hôtel Le Puy d'Alon. The Pech Merle, Church of Sainte Marie and Musee de l'Automate are some of the most popular attractions to experience when you're in Souillac.
